Output 8fe3c9ea0aa573d32649926048ebb7a6efd5de7243efda9c05f420b42836e2d3:0

value
2558881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fcbdd6672e6647848fd0d4be57981a368f6dc9a OP_EQUAL
address
363juLXcnxtzrtuQwai2rMVycoYCkeNzpf
transaction
8fe3c9ea0aa573d32649926048ebb7a6efd5de7243efda9c05f420b42836e2d3